Vocabulary : Stomachful to Stomata

Stomachful : Willfully obstinate; stubborn; perverse.
Stomachic : Alt. of Stomachical ;; A medicine that strengthens the stomach and excites its action.
Stomachical : Of or pertaining to the stomach; as, stomachic vessels. ;; Strengthening to the stomach; exciting the action of the stomach; stomachal; cordial.
Stomaching : of Stomach ;; Resentment.
Stomachless : Being without a stomach. ;; Having no appetite.
Stomachous : Stout; sullen; obstinate.
Stomachy : Obstinate; sullen; haughty.
Stomapod : One of the Stomapoda.
Stomapoda : An order of Crustacea including the squillas. The maxillipeds are leglike in form, and the large claws are comblike. They have a large and elongated abdomen, which contains a part of the stomach and heart; the abdominal appendages are large, and bear the gills. Called also Gastrula, Stomatopoda, and Squilloidea.
